MACHINE LEARNING BASED TIMING ADVANCE UPDATES

    Abstract: Methods, systems, and devices for wireless communications at a user equipment (UE) are described. A UE may identify one or more measurement parameters to use for input in a machine learning (ML) model. In some cases, the measurement parameters may include reference signal received power measurements or a past set of timing advance (TA) values for a specific node. The UE may predict the TA based on inputting the measurement parameters into the ML model. The UE may transmit an uplink communication from the UE to a network entity using the TA predicted from the ML model. In some examples, the UE may transmit a capability report to indicate that the UE may support autonomous update of the TA based on the predictions of the TA values produced from the ML model.

    INTER-USER EQUIPMENT COORDINATION FOR BEAMFORMED COMMUNICATIONS

    Abstract: Methods, systems, and devices for wireless communications that support inter-user equipment (UE) coordination (IUC) for beamformed communications are described. A first UE may receive, using a first spatial filter, a first sidelink control message including a first sidelink resource reservation associated with a second UE. Additionally, or alternatively, the first UE may receive, using a second spatial filter, a second sidelink control message including a second sidelink resource reservation associated with a third UE. The first UE may transmit, to the second UE or the third UE, an IUC message that indicates a conflict between the first sidelink resource reservation and the second sidelink resource reservation. The IUC message that indicates a conflict may be based on a relationship between the first spatial filter used to receive the first sidelink resource reservation and the second spatial filter used to receive the second sidelink resource reservation.

    SYSTEMS AND METHODS FOR SIDELINK SENSING WITH BEAMFORMING

    Abstract: Disclosed is a method for wireless communication. The method comprises: determining a first set of slots within a sidelink resource pool, determining a set of candidate single-slot resources, each candidate single-slot resource associated with a slot of the first set of slots, determining a second set of slots within the sidelink resource pool based on the first set of slots, wherein the first set of slots and the second set of slots do not overlap, monitoring for one or more transmissions comprising control information in each slot of the second set of slots, wherein the monitoring comprises using a receive beam, selectively excluding, based on the control information, one or more resources from the set of candidate single-slot resources, and transmitting a sidelink transmission in one or more remaining resources of the set of candidate single-slot resources.

    BEAM REPORT ENHANCEMENTS FOR BEAM PREDICTION

    Abstract: Methods, systems, and devices for wireless communications are described. A user equipment (UE) may receive control signaling identifying, for multiple beams, a set of quantized values for beam measurement reporting. The UE may receive a set of reference signals and each reference signal may be associated with a beam of the multiple beams. The UE may transmit a report indicating a set of power values that are based on the set of quantized values and the set of reference signals. Each power value of the set of power values may be associated with a respective beam of the multiple beams. The control signaling may also indicate a set of rules for vector-based beam management reporting for the multiple beams. The report may include a vector report and may indicate the set of power values based on the set of rules and the set of reference signals.
